WebOdor Bleach Precautionary Statements - Prevention Wash face, hands and any exposed skin thoroughly after handling. Wear protective gloves, protective clothing, face protection, and eye protection such as safety glasses. Precautionary Statements - Response Immediately call a poison center or doctor. If swallowed: Rinse mouth. Do NOT induce vomiting. WebOct 6, 2024 · Soaking Your Towels in a Bleach Solution Download Article 1 Pour 1 gallon (3.8 L) of cool water and 1⁄4 cup (59 mL) of bleach into a large bucket. If you have more towels to bleach, you may need more water. Add 1⁄4 cup (59 mL) of bleach for every additional 1 gallon (3.8 L) of water.
